1. Understanding HDB-Style Housing and Relocation in Malaysia
While “HDB” is a Singapore term, many Malaysians use it to describe similar residential setups, especially high-rise apartments and flats designed for compact urban living. These include:
- Medium-cost apartments
- Government quarters
- Public housing flats
- Affordable high-rise units
- Low-cost flats
- Walk-up flats
- Modern apartments with shared lifts
Due to structural similarities, challenges such as narrow corridors, tight entryways, small lifts, and building restrictions make HDB Relocation in Malaysia comparable to Singapore’s HDB moving process. This is where specialized movers play a crucial role.

2.3 Compliance With Management Rules
Most high-rise buildings in Malaysia enforce rules such as:
- Move-in/move-out time slots
- Lift booking
- Security registration
- Deposit payments
- Restrictions on weekends or holidays
Experienced movers know these procedures well and help you avoid penalties.

4. HDB-Style Moving Costs in Malaysia
The cost of HDB Relocation in Malaysia depends on the size of your home, the distance, the complexity of the move, and additional services.
4.1 Estimated Moving Costs
| Home Type | Estimated Cost (RM) |
|---|---|
| Studio / 1 Room | 350 – 700 |
| 2 Room Flat | 700 – 1,200 |
| 3 Room Apartment | 1,000 – 1,600 |
| 4 Room Unit | 1,400 – 2,200 |
| 5 Room Unit | 1,800 – 3,000+ |
4.2 Additional Charges
- Long walking distances: RM 50 – 150
- No lift / lift breakdown: RM 80 – 200 per floor
- Wrapping of large items: from RM 5 per item
- Weekend surcharge: up to 20%
- Dismantling built-ins: extra cost
Always request a detailed quotation to avoid surprises.

7. Essential Tips to Prepare for HDB-Style Relocation
Follow these steps for a smooth move:
7.1 Book the Lift Ahead of Time
Most management offices require at least 3-5 days notice.
7.2 Declutter Before Packing
Sell, donate, or recycle unused items.
7.3 Pack an Essentials Bag
Keep important items such as:
- Medications
- Keys
- Wallet
- Toiletries
- Chargers
7.4 Protect Fragile Items
Use proper cushioning materials.
7.5 Label Everything Clearly
This speeds up both loading and unpacking.
7.6 Take Photos of Valuable Items
Useful for insurance claims, especially during HDB Relocation in Malaysia.
8. Challenges Movers Face During HDB-Style Relocation
High-rise relocation is complex and requires skill.
8.1 Tight Spaces
Older flats have narrow stairways and compact entrances.
8.2 Lift Restrictions
Some lifts are too small for large wardrobes or mattresses.
8.3 Management Restrictions
Many buildings limit moving hours or prohibit moves on certain days.
8.4 Weather Problems
Heavy rain can cause delays or require additional wrapping.
8.5 Parking Limitations
Lorries may need special permission to park near the entrance.

10. FAQs About HDB-Style Relocation in Malaysia
Q1: How early should I book movers?
At least 1–2 weeks ahead.
Q2: Do movers provide packing materials?
Yes, most offer boxes, bubble wrap, and tapes.
Q3: Can movers dismantle and reassemble furniture?
Yes, especially for beds, wardrobes, and tables.
Q4: How long does an HDB-style move take?
Usually 3–6 hours depending on the unit size and floors.
Q5: Can movers handle fragile electronics?
Yes, professional movers pack TVs, computers, and monitors securely.
